Bengaluru Sees Embassy Greenshore Sell 450 Units Worth Rs 860 Crore Rapidly

Embassy Developments has recorded one of its strongest early sales performances in recent years, selling more than 450 apartments within five days of launching its latest residential project in north Bengaluru. The development, part of the larger Embassy Springs township, has generated an estimated Rs 860 crore in bookings, signalling continued demand for well-planned homes in the city’s rapidly growing northern corridor.

Spread across 14 acres inside the 288-acre township, the new project introduces over 878 apartments across two-, three-, and four-bedroom configurations. Phase One alone accounts for 700 units and more than 1.3 million sq ft of saleable area. Located close to Kempegowda International Airport and major employment districts, the scheme benefits from the township’s integrated ecosystem, which includes educational, recreational, and green infrastructure aimed at fostering more sustainable urban living. A senior company executive said the response reflects an increasing preference for homes that offer “greater spatial comfort and privacy,” particularly as working households look for long-term flexibility. Industry analysts note that Bengaluru’s newer townships are gaining traction because they accommodate broader urban needs adequate open spaces, mobility connectivity, and access to essential services elements often missing in cramped inner-city micro-markets. Embassy Developments has signalled its intention to maintain expansion momentum in the region, with plans to introduce six new residential projects worth roughly Rs 10,300 crore over the next few years.

These launches, concentrated across north Bengaluru, represent more than 5.6 million sq ft of premium development potential in the form of apartments and villas. Two of these projects Embassy Greenshore and Embassy Verde Phase II have already secured RERA approval, reinforcing the company’s pipeline readiness. The company is also preparing a major launch in Hebbal, where a 10-acre premium development is expected to add more than 600 homes in three- and four-bedroom formats. Located beside an existing high-end community, the project is positioned for buyers seeking modern layouts and efficient floor plans. Urban planners point out that the north Bengaluru belt is evolving into a key residential cluster due to improved connectivity, upcoming metro expansion, and job growth from technology and aviation-linked industries. As the demand base widens, developers are increasingly emphasising liveability features such as climate-sensitive master planning, optimised building orientation, and generous green buffers elements that contribute to healthier, lower-carbon neighbourhoods.

For homebuyers, the sustained momentum suggests that integrated townships may continue to outperform standalone city projects, especially as households prioritise access to open space, reduced commute times, and more equitable community amenities. For the wider city, the concentration of new launches in planned districts may ease pressure on congested cores, contributing to more balanced and resilient urban growth.
